Linoleum Flooring Replacement Questions
What are the benefits of replacing linoleum flooring? Replacing linoleum can enhance the appearance of a space and improve durability, making it easier to maintain over time.
How can I tell if my linoleum needs to be replaced? Signs include significant wear, cracking, fading, or damage that cannot be repaired effectively.
What types of flooring options are available as replacements for linoleum? Options include vinyl, laminate, tile, or hardwood flooring, depending on style and durability preferences.
Is linoleum flooring replacement su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, replacing linoleum with more durable materials can be beneficial in areas with heavy foot traffic.
